- The distance between Santa Elena, Venezuela and Minya, Egypt is approximately 9,948 km or 6,182 mi.
- To reach Santa Elena in this distance one would set out from Minya bearing 274.9° or W and follow the great circles arc to approach Santa Elena bearing 241.9° or WSW .
- Santa Elena has a tropical monsoonal climate (Am) whereas Minya has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h).
- Santa Elena is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ome whereas Minya is in or near the subtropical desert biome.
- The mean temperature is 0.2 °C (0.3°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 15.5 °C (27.9°F) less in Santa Elena. The continentality subtype is extremely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1689 mm (66.5 in) more which is equivalent to 1689 l/m² (41.45 US gal/ft²) or 16,890,000 l/ha (1,805,653 US gal/ac) more. About 338 4/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 12.6° higher in Santa Elena than in Minya.
- Relative humidity levels are 30.3% higher.
- The mean dew point temperature is 7.5°C (13.5°F) higher.
